Abstract

This article is part of a current research project on the topic of political socialization in secondary schools in Portugal. Our aim is to describe the background to political socialization at school in the light of the school experience today, the school as institution, and the role of educational critiques and reforms. The article goes on to question recent mechanisms designed to put «education for citizenship» on the formal curriculum. It concludes by questioning the place of «education for citizenship» in the ambivalent context of student life today.
